What Could Be Better
- I wish the cord was a little longer for larger kitchens.
- The blender works best with soft foods instead of very hard items.
- I noticed the handle can feel warm after long blending sessions.
- There is no storage cup included in the box.
- I had to hold the power button the whole time while blending.
- The motor may feel less powerful compared to expensive premium models.
